IF THE RESOLUTIONS ARE NOT PASSED OR IF THE SCHEME OF ARRANGEMENT DOES NOT RECEIVE THE APPROVAL OF THE SCHEME CREDITORS AND THE COURT THEN THE COMPANY MAY BE WOUND UP SAVE IN THE EVENT OF AN OFFER BEING RECEIVED. CERTAIN PARTS OF THE GROUP WILL BE UNLIKELY TO BE IN A POSITION TO MEET THEIR LIABILITIES AS THEY FALL DUE, FORCING THE DIRECTORS TO EITHER PLACE ASSETCO PLC INTO ADMINISTRATION, SELL IT ON LESS FAVOURABLE TERMS OR RESULT IN THE COMPANY BEING WOUND UP BY THE COURT. IN SUCH CIRCUMSTANCES, IT IS NOT EXPECTED THAT THE SHAREHOLDERS WOULD RECEIVE MORE THAN NOMINAL VALUE FOR THEIR CURRENT SHAREHOLDING. 9/9/2011 12:45pm TEMPORARY SUSPENSION OF TRADING ON AIM ASSETCO PLC Trading on AIM for the under-mentioned securities has been temporarily suspended from 9/9/2011 12:45am pending publication of the annual audited accounts Ordinary Shares of 25p each (3399738) (GB0033997387) If you have any queries relating to the above, please contact the company's nominated adviser on 020 7614 5917
